Output 4584775911dc74b5f5ea2317b4e2922657055983e20bfe6b95131bc8c452176e:0

value
18149587
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c5f0ae107163942d53eb0d2cf24e5508c6988727 OP_EQUAL
address
3KjdN4zWR8Rm58Efj7spchhER7ksDTqFgk
transaction
4584775911dc74b5f5ea2317b4e2922657055983e20bfe6b95131bc8c452176e
spent
true